A big thanks to Friends of Adelaide International Bird Sanctuary (FAIBS) members, volunteers and NPWS for another clean up effort at Thompson Beach last week.

On Sunday, 15th March, around 20 people joined National Parks and Wildlife’s Ranger Erik and FAIBS members for bird viewing and dunes clean-up.

FAIBS described the amount and range of rubbish collected as “disturbing” – several trailer loads worth were removed from an area at the back of Thompson Beach. Looks like there were a lot of tires among it.

What a fantastic effort that builds on the recent work carried out on Clean Up Australia Day.

But as FAIBS notes, we all look forward to a day when this type of activity won’t be necessary. Let’s hope that day actually comes.
